Logo
banner-image
Cosmetics store
Unclaimed
SEPHORA
logo
SEPHORA
(818) 506-3166
sephora.com/happening/stores/california-studio-city
00 Likes
media-photo
media-photo
media-photo
media-photo
Primary Location
Main location12036 Ventura Blvd Studio City California 91604 US(818) 506-3166
Retail chain with a selection of upmarket makeup, perfumes, beauty & skincare products.
Loading...
Loading...
Home
Businesses
Marketplace